The Regional Government announced its intention to extend the collective agreement of the transport company CARRISTUR, opening a 10-day period for objections.
The Regional Secretariat for Inclusion, Work and Youth has made public a notice regarding the draft ordinance for the extension of the company agreement of CARRISTUR - Inovação em Transportes Urbanos e Regionais, Sociedade Unipessoal Lda..
The agreement in question was signed with the Federação dos Sindicatos de Transportes e Comunicações - FECTRANS and published in the Boletim do Trabalho e Emprego (Labour and Employment Bulletin). If approved, the extension would apply the conditions of this agreement to all CARRISTUR workers in Madeira who are not represented by the signing union.
Under the law, interested parties – individuals or legal entities that may be affected by the decision – have a period of 10 days, counted from the publication of this notice, to submit a reasoned objection in writing.
This public consultation process is a legal requirement before the final issuance of the extension ordinance, which will have effects limited to the territory of the Autonomous Region of Madeira.
